THE BINGO HALL
By: Shane McKenzie

Samhain Publishing
November 2014
On Sale: November 4, 2014
Featuring: Chris; Oscar; Jay
ISBN: 1619222612
EAN: 9781619222618
Kindle: B00NPSOCBM
e-Book (reprint)
Add to Wish List

Horror

This isn’t your grandmother’s bingo game.

One day, mysterious fliers appear on all the doors in the neighborhood, announcing a new bingo hall, Big Time Bingo. Players are lured in by the promise of free money and big prizes. Like all the other kids, Chris and his friends Oscar and Jay are dragged along by their moms and other relatives, but Chris gets the nagging feeling that something is very off about the strange man who runs it, Mr. Big. As the nights at the bingo hall pass Chris and Oscar realize something horrible is going on. No longer are the patrons there to have fun. They now play bingo to WIN, and become extremely soreβ€”and violentβ€”losers when they lose. As the adults get hypnotized by the game, it’s up to Chris and his friends to stop Mr. Big before their town is driven completely crazy by greed and chaos.

This book has been previously published.
